Job Description
Job Summary
We are seeking a professional and organized Dental Receptionist to join our dental practice. The ideal candidate will serve as the first point of contact for patients, providing exceptional customer service while managing administrative tasks efficiently. This role requires a friendly demeanor, strong communication skills, and familiarity with dental office operations to ensure a smooth patient experience and support the clinical team effectively. We are a small three operatory general practice clinic with many long-standing clients. Hours are generally Monday to Thursday 8:00am - 4:00pm and Friday as a flexible administrative day. No evenings or weekends.
Duties
Greet patients warmly and check them in for appointments using Gold software.
Manage multi-line phone systems to schedule appointments, answer inquiries, and relay messages accurately.
Verify patient insurance information and update records accordingly.
Prepare and organize patient charts, ensuring all necessary documentation is complete and current.
Collect payments, co-pays, and outstanding balances at the time of service.
Assist with administrative tasks including filing, data entry, and maintaining a clean front desk area.
Coordinate appointment scheduling with the dental team to optimize daily operations.
Handle correspondence via email or mail as needed, ensuring timely communication with patients.
Maintain confidentiality of patient information in compliance with HIPAA regulations.
Qualifications
Prior experience as a dental receptionist is required.
Proficiency with dental practice management software such as Gold is desirable.
Strong knowledge of terminology relevant to dental care is necessary.
Experience working with electronic records systems and office equipment.
Excellent organizational skills with attention to detail and accuracy in data entry.
Ability to handle multi-line phone systems efficiently while maintaining professionalism.
Exceptional communication skills, both verbal and written, with a friendly and empathetic demeanor.
Previous experience working in a fast-paced office environment is advantageous.
Knowledge of insurance verification processes and billing procedures is required.
